Output 60aa7ba738798b08fb3439fe614abd40ef3dc3522e5512367a757bddc3f1570d:21

value
506880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b03bb148eb1bb37a7ff1e6078de685e4245cc7 OP_EQUAL
address
3MGBeVSA8yqQbyr65SucQ6HxzSsGTeZpGA
transaction
60aa7ba738798b08fb3439fe614abd40ef3dc3522e5512367a757bddc3f1570d
spent
true